What's the probability you will flip 3 coins in a row and they all land on HEADS?

Answer:

B. 1/8 chance

Step-by-step explanation:

Every time you flip a coin you have a 1/2 probability of landing on heads.

If you repeated the process three times in the row

It would be 1/2 x 1/2 x 1/2 = 1/8

The odds they all land on heads is 1/8

what is the slope and equation of a line that is perpendicular to the y-axis passing through (-5,-3)?​
Illusion [34]

Answer:

Slope is m=0

y=-3

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ope of any line that is perpendicular to the y-axis is zero.

The reason is that any line that is perpendicular to the y-axis is also parallel to the x-axis and the slope of the x-axis is zero.

The equation of any line perpendicular to the y-axis is and passes through (a,b) is y=b.

The given point is (-5,-3) hence the required equation is

y=-3
